The defendants,  Andrew Bigelow, Pankesh Patel, Lee Tolleson and John Wier, were accused of attempting to bribe two individuals who were posing as representatives of the defense ministry of the African nation of Gabon in order to win a $15 million deal to provide guns, body armor and other equipment.   As reported here, on July 21, 2011, the four defendants who had been tried (Pankesh Patel, John Benson Wier, Andrew Bigelow and Lee Allen Tolleson) filed a renewed Rule 29 motion for judgment of acquittal, arguing that the Government's theory that all 22 defendants acted as part of a single interdependent conspiracy was "unprecedented, unsustainable and unsupported.
